Three adults have been taken to hospital following a two-vehicle crash on a gravel road near Hazelridge, Man., on Monday afternoon.

RCMP say two women and one man were taken to hospital in stable condition as a result of the collision.

An infant who was in one of the vehicles was uninjured, according to police.

RCMP say they believe the collision may have been caused by reduced visibility, as a lot of dust was being kicked up from the gravel road.
